Course Content

• Crafting Compelling Narratives for Artists: This unit focuses on structuring narratives effectively, incorporating conflict and resolution, and developing memorable characters relevant to the artist's work.
• Visual Storytelling Techniques for Artists: This unit explores the use of imagery, composition, and visual metaphors to enhance storytelling power within the visual arts.
• The Artist's Voice and Brand Identity: Developing a unique artistic voice and building a strong brand identity to connect with audiences.
• Storytelling through Different Media: This unit covers adapting storytelling approaches for various media, including painting, sculpture, photography, digital art, and performance art.
• Marketing and Promotion Strategies for Artists: Leveraging storytelling to market artwork and build a following through social media, website creation, and press releases.
• Building an Artist Portfolio that Tells a Story: Curating a portfolio that showcases not only skill but also a cohesive narrative and artistic vision.
• Understanding Your Audience: Identifying target audiences and tailoring storytelling strategies to resonate with specific demographics.
• Storytelling and the Art of Collaboration: This unit explores how effective communication through storytelling facilitates collaboration with galleries, curators, and other artists.

Career path

Career Role Description
Storytelling Consultant (Film & TV) Develop compelling narratives for film and television productions, collaborating with writers and directors. High demand for skilled narrative architects.
Interactive Storytelling Designer (Games) Craft engaging narratives for video games, integrating gameplay mechanics with narrative design. A rapidly growing field with excellent career prospects in UK game studios.
Digital Storytelling Producer (Marketing) Create and manage digital storytelling projects for marketing campaigns. Strong visual communication and storytelling skills essential for success in this competitive sector.
Narrative Designer (XR/Metaverse) Design immersive and interactive storytelling experiences for virtual and augmented reality applications. An emerging field offering unique storytelling opportunities.
Storytelling Specialist (Museums/Heritage) Develop engaging narratives for museum exhibitions and heritage sites, communicating complex information to diverse audiences. Excellent communication & public engagement skills needed.
